56 hp, 947 cc SOHC four-cylinder engine, two SU side-draft carburettors, four-speed manual transmission, front and rear suspension by semi-elliptic springs with solid axles, four-wheel mechanical brakes. Wheelbase: 87.25"
- 1935 MG P-Series Le Mans works car from all-women’s team
- First team car home, driven by Joan Richmond and Barbara Simpson
- The only original car remaining: one was modified, one is presumed destroyed
